India Monitors Chabahar Port Amid Rising Iran–Israel Tensions Intensifying

The ongoing hostilities between Iran and Israel, marked by recent military exchanges and diplomatic standoffs, have raised alarm among nations with vital interests in the area. For India, Chabahar Port is not only a vital gateway to Afghanistan and Central Asia but also a cornerstone of New Delhi’s efforts to bypass Pakistan and foster regional economic integration.

Officials from India’s Ministry of External Affairs confirmed that the government is “actively monitoring the security and operational status of Chabahar Port” and is in constant communication with Iranian authorities and on-ground Indian port management teams. Command and control protocols have reportedly been strengthened in recent days as the situation in the region evolves.

The Geopolitical Weight of Chabahar Port

India’s investment in Chabahar Port dates back several years, with more than $500 million committed to its development and operations. The port allows India to directly access Afghanistan and further into Central Asia, circumventing Pakistan, which has traditionally limited overland access.

Chabahar Port also serves as a counterbalance to Pakistan’s Gwadar Port, developed by China under the Belt and Road Initiative. Given its strategic significance, any turmoil at the port could have far-reaching economic and security implications for India’s trade ambitions and its position in regional geopolitics.

“The Chabahar Port is not just a commercial asset but also a strategic linchpin for India’s connectivity with Afghanistan and the region,” said Dr. Harsh V. Pant, a strategic studies expert at Observer Research Foundation. “Escalation between Iran and Israel increases the chance of spillover, which can jeopardize the security of Indian investments and shipments.”

Short-Term Safeguards and Contingency Planning

Shipping lines and logistics operators working with the Indian-run terminal at Chabahar have reportedly received advisories regarding heightened vigilance, cargo tracing, and security drills. The Indian Ports Global Limited (IPGL), the state-run company operating Chabahar’s Shahid Beheshti Terminal, has confirmed the implementation of new security protocols and direct communication channels with Indian consular officials in Iran.

In a recent statement, an IPGL spokesperson noted, “We have increased our risk assessments and are working closely with local security personnel to ensure the safety of workers and cargo. The port remains fully operational, though we remain alert to any changes.”

The Ministry of External Affairs declined to comment on operational specifics but stressed the importance of Chabahar to India’s “vision of regional connectivity and trade resilience.”

Global Trade and Energy Security at Risk

The port’s location near the Strait of Hormuz—the world’s most critical oil chokepoint—underscores the gravity of emerging threats. The International Energy Agency (IEA) has cautioned that any conflict-related disruptions in the region could impact global supply chains, including energy corridors vital to India and other Asian economies.

“Given the current volatility, any escalation in the Gulf will not only threaten shipping but also put at risk strategic infrastructure like Chabahar,” said retired Rear Admiral Shekhar Sinha, a maritime security analyst. “India must be ready with robust contingency plans, including alternative routes and insurance for cargoes.”

Diplomatic Engagements and Regional Coordination

Apart from security measures, India has intensified diplomatic engagements with Iran and other regional stakeholders to de-escalate tensions. Foreign Secretary Vinay Kwatra reportedly discussed the safety of Indian citizens and commercial interests in Iran with his Iranian counterpart earlier this week, reiterating India’s call for restraint and dialogue.

Analysts believe that India’s stakes at Chabahar—both economic and symbolic—necessitate a proactive approach, balancing diplomatic engagement with operational preparedness.

Broader Implications and The Road Ahead

The renewed India-Iran Chabahar agreement signed last month, granting India a 10-year operational lease, further underscores the port’s importance to New Delhi. However, regional instability remains a persistent threat.

With Iran-Israel tensions showing little sign of abating, India is likely to maintain heightened vigilance and may adjust its investments or operational footprint if security conditions deteriorate.

As the situation continues to unfold, the government’s response at Chabahar will be closely watched, both at home and by global stakeholders invested in the stability of Persian Gulf trade routes.
